    Gordon do you have problems with audio sync when recording. Apparently there is an issue with WA PVR's being sent irregular buffers on WIN, Go, Gem, Ten and Eleven. It seems to be everything that originates from Ingleburn, NSW.

    I have found that if I pause live play, when I restart the delayed program it will run OK for approx 15 seconds (sometimes longer) and the the audio will jump out of sync with audio playing about 10 to 15 seconds ahead of the picture. If I fast forward or jump back, the audio will sync for the next 15 seconds and then jump out again. The same thing happens if I try to play a recorded program. Very annoying and makes the PVR useless for these channels.

    UEC claim it's a stream issue from the 9 & 10 networks affecting audio sync on the WA VAST feeds.

    The problem is only evident on recordings, not live viewing.

    They are aware of the issue and are said to be working on a fix.... which we be an OTA firmware upgrade.... oh no... here we go again.
